The area of a rectangle is 24,396 square centimeters. If the width is 38 centimeters, what is the length?

The length of the rectangle is 642 centimeters when the area is 24,396 square centimeters and the width is 38 centimeters. This is determined using the formula for area: Area = Length × Width. By rearranging the formula to solve for length and performing division, we find the answer.
